Key questions answered
- Which steps stay human? — Interview calibration, offers, onboarding welcome, and exceptions.
- How do we design guardrails? — Human override, disclosures, and accessibility testing.
- How do we track impact? — Candidate satisfaction, acceptance rate, and time-in-stage.
Where to keep humans
- Interview calibration, offer conversations, and onboarding welcome.
- Feedback loops after assessments and key interviews.
- Edge cases: exceptions, accommodations, and escalations.
Guardrails
- Public disclosure of automation use.
- Human override for automated decisions.
- Accessibility and fairness checks for all automations.
